Ahahah XD Currently it's "If you're happy and you know it, mate with your ball", the wings are curving around and everything. Always makes me laugh when he does that because he gets so flustered and is wobbling back and forth, and then loses his balance and goes tumbling XD One time he actually rolled over ;D ;D ;D
Yesterday, however, it was "If you're happy and you know it, poop in mummy's bath water and then drink some of said water" which really doesn't go with the song, but yeah... Bath didn't last much longer after that, mainly because the water had had bath salts in it and I was determiined to get Munchy drinking clean water. He only had two mouthfuls and there was a lot of water, so everything was really diluted, but he's as perky as ever today so I think I got lucky. No more baths salts when he's around, that's for sure!
